Attic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in your roof Yes No DIY repairs are usually fine for small leaks, but it’s essential to inspect the area for any further damage.
Standing water in your attic No Yes Standing water can lead to mold growth and structural damage, making it a job for a professional.
High humidity or mold growth No Yes Mold can be hazardous to your health, and high humidity can lead to further damage, making it a job for a professional.
Roof damage or replacement No Yes Roof damage or replacement needs specialized equipment and expertise, making it a job for a professional.
Water damage in multiple areas No Yes Water damage in multiple areas needs a comprehensive inspection and repair plan, making it a job for a professional.

Attic Water Damage Restoration Cost In Lynden, WA

The cost of Attic Water Damage Restoration in Lynden, WA,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al and Dr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area, the amount of standing water, and the type of equipment needed.
Demolition and Cleanup $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age, the type of materials removed, and the disposal costs.
Repairs and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The type and extent of repairs needed, the materials used, and the labor costs.
Final Inspection and Cleanup Free – $500 The complexity of the job and the amount of time needed for the final inspection and cleanup.
